The labyrinthine plot of Bleak House focuses on a seemingly endless inheritance dispute. Dozens of characters, including the innocent young narrator Esther Summerson, her friends Richard Carstone and Ada Clare, and the jaded aristocrats Sir and Lady Dedlock, are directly or indirectly caught up in the case. Written in bold and inventive language, it is Dicken's epic vision of Victorian society. The critical introduction and appendices to this edition focus on the novel's social context and reception.
